87-year-old Hall of Famer Al Attles, a longtime member of the Golden State Warriors organization, passed away surrounded by his family. Known as "The Destroyer", Attles spent his entire professional career with the team, being drafted to the Philadelphia Warriors in 1960. During his 11-year career, he averaged 8.9 points, 3.5 assists, and 3.5 rebounds per game. After retiring, Attles transitioned into coaching, serving as the Warriors' assistant coach from 1968 to 1970 and head coach until 1983. He helped guide the team to an NBA championship in 1975. Attles earned his spot in the Naismith Memorial Basketball Hall of Fame in 2019 and the John R. Bunn Lifetime Achievement Award in 2014.
